Energy Sector Drawing Venture Capital Interest

By: Marketwire .
Jun. 15, 2010 10:08 AM

ROCKVILLE, MD -- (Marketwire) -- 06/15/10 -- MarketResearch.com has announced the addition of Aruvian's R'search's new report "Analyzing Venture Capital Options in the Energy Industry," to their collection of Investment Banking & Venture Capital market reports. For more information, visit http://www.marketresearch.com/product/display.asp?ProductID=2683971.

The Energy Industry has seen the constant interest of financial activity from various sectors often interlinked or sometimes cross industry. A more serious effort in this arena has been taken up by Venture capitalists (VC) who have been important drivers in the financing of innovative start-ups in several industries. Venture Funds dedicated to the energy industry are showing robust activity by pumping in increasing amounts of financial muscle into new and emerging energy technologies. The Government continues to play the role of the primary financer by supplying a steady stream of investment dollars in new and emerging energy technologies. Nevertheless, the heightened investment activity by the venture capitalists has forced many industry experts to sit up and take notice.

A mere approximate period of seven years has passed since the entry of venture capital funds in the energy industry. Though the government plays the role of the initiator of technology development for long term future prospects, the interest of venture funds is more focused on achieving quantifiable returns to investments in the medium run. This changes the nature of investment from VC's to business expansion capital.

Though the present relative comparison of venture capital investment infusion in the energy sector may appear miniscule when compared to software or the Internet; the past five years have certainly shown more than promise of phases to come with climbing surges of investment flows.
